Yes, I reproduced it. However, after changing the Conflict rule in
jed/debian/control, it works.
> > * install of the new version with dpkg:
>
> Wrong way! dpkg does not resolve dependencies. Use apt!
Testing should be done with the worst case in mind. While dpkg doesnot
resolve dependencies automagically,
* it should refuse to install a package with unmet dependencies
* it should cleanly install a set of interdependent packages given at
the command line
* it is still the tool of choice for installing individually downloaded
packages
(I prefer to download jed packages from experimental over adding
"experimental" to the sources.list -- otherwise my "vintage" system
would have a hard time coping with the huge database.)
I am not sure, whether moving the
Conflicts: jed-extra (<= 1.0-1)
from jed-common to jed and xjed is "the right way" and I would prefer
to know exactly what is going on, however
* it works (at least for me)
* jed-common 0.99.18 can actually happily coexist with jed-extra <= 1.0-1
As long as there is no jed or xjed installed, both of them will be
largely useless but not broken.
* OTOH, jed 0.99.18 and xjed 0.99.18 use SLang 2, which breaks some
of the modes in jed-extra 1.0-1.
